How to hide page title on one page?:
I want to hide the page title on one page. There is no option in the page settings to select “-no title”. I don’t want to code the custom css to hide all page titles. The theme I am using is a word press theme called Simple Catch. I have been just leaving the site title blank to work around this for now but I then see no title in the Pages Section of the Dashboard and have to find the page by the ID nujmber only – cumbersome. More importantly, page titles affect SEO.

The instances of SiteOrigin documentation or forum posts referring to a page setting are unfortunately for SiteOrigin themes. For third-party themes, the theme author would be best positioned to lend a hand.
Thank you for the response. To clarify, even though I am using the SiteOrigin page builder it is the theme that dictates the option for more robust page settings? Third party theme rules?
You’re most welcome. That’s correct; Page Builder isn’t in control of the page title, the theme is handling the output and styling of the page title.

If you have a bit of time, you could perhaps use a child theme and create a Page Template option without the page title. Any of the Large Language Models like ChatGPT will be able to help with that quite easily.
